When should I stay at a B&B in Enniskerry?
When you’re dreaming of a trip to Enniskerry,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Enniskerry is 899 mm.
What is there to do in Enniskerry?
If you like to experience a new place through your taste buds, you’ll definitely enjoy Enniskerry for its restaurants and bars. Spend some time exploring Powerscourt Estate and Powerscourt Waterfall if you’re hoping to see some of the area’s natural features. You should put ESPA at Powerscourt Hotel and Wicklow Mountains National Park on your list if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Enniskerry?
Mapping out your trip in and around Enniskerry is easy with these transportation options. Fly into Dublin Airport (DUB), which is located 17.9 mi (28.8 km) from the heart of the city. If you’d like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to explore more sights.
